Re: Tarnwell Components contract renewal

Quick update before Thursday's session. Our supply agreement with Tarnwell expires in August, and they've signalled a price increase of around 9%, citing raw material costs. We've benchmarked against Greymoor Fabrication and one other alternative; switching would take roughly six months and carry real transition risk. Procurement recommends renewing for two years with a capped escalator, keeping options open. The broader thinking behind that recommendation is set out below.

confidential, kagep-kahof: Druokax Systems plans to lower the Ulaath list price by 53 percent in March.

Changelog 4.2.0 — Cold start defaults changed

We changed the default warm-pool behavior for Fenncast serverless handlers after repeated cold-start pages last quarter. Handlers now pre-initialize the Briarlight runtime and keep two warm instances per region instead of zero. On-call: expect slightly higher idle cost and fewer latency alerts. If you see regressions, note that the new defaults ship as the following values.

config for kafof-bawef:
holath:
  log_level: debug
  metrics_host: metrics.holath.qorvelsys.internal
  pin: 2191
  pool_size: 32

## TICKET: Config drift on Brindlewick partner SFTP drop

During the quarterly audit of the Marrowgate ingestion pipeline, we found the partner SFTP drop's live configuration diverged from what's tracked in source control. Cipher restrictions were loosened and the chroot path changed, with no corresponding change record. Please review carefully before we reconcile. For comparison against the repository baseline, the values currently active on the host are listed below.

settings of hagug-yawip:
druix:
  pin: 0136
  metrics_host: metrics.druix.qorvellabs.internal
  tenant: kelox
  seal: seal_71ff4acd

**Bulk Edits in the Kestrelboard Admin Table**

New hires: bulk edits are powerful and irreversible past 24 hours. Select rows with the checkbox column, pick an action from the Batch menu, confirm twice. Never bulk-edit the `tenants` table without a second reviewer. Dry-run mode is default on staging, off in prod. If a bulk job locks the table, escalate to the Mirewood on-call rotation. To unlock the recovery console, use the passphrase below.

vault phrase of tahop-kahap = oliwyn-praax